
Riot Games has finalized the field for VALORANT Masters Toronto, set to run June 7–22 at the Enercare Centre in Toronto. Twelve teams representing four global regions will vie for a share of the sizable prize pool and valuable Championship Points over the three-week event.
The competition brings together the top three squads from Stage 1 of each international league: VCT Pacific, VCT China, VCT Americas and VCT EMEA. Pacific league champion XERXIA Regnum Qeon, China’s XLG Esports, Americas titleholder G2 Esports and EMEA winner Fnatic earn byes into the Playoffs. The remaining eight teams begin in the Swiss Stage on June 7, where squads must secure two wins to advance or suffer elimination after two defeats.
VCT Pacific will also send Gen.G and Paper Rex into the Swiss bracket after they finished second and third in the regional finals. From VCT China, Bilibili Gaming and Wolves Esports join XLG Esports after Edward Gaming fell short of a top-three finish. VCT Americas is represented by Sentinels and Made in Brazil alongside G2, while Team Heretics and Team Liquid fill the second and third seeds from VCT EMEA.

The Swiss Stage features matchups between teams with identical records, narrowing the field to four survivors who will face the four direct Playoff qualifiers. Playoffs commence June 13 under a double-elimination format, with best-of-three matches until the Lower Bracket Final and Grand Final, both best-of-five, conclude the tournament on June 22.
Championship Points likewise reward the top finishers, with the winner earning seven points, five for second and four for third. Remaining prize money and points are distributed based on final standings, ensuring every team competes for both financial and seasonal stakes.
